SUMMARY:Annual Messiah Sing-in Returns with Fresh Additions December 6
DESCRIPTION:Saturday\, December 6 | 7:00 pm\nCentral Lutheran Church\n259 W. Wabasha st.\nWinona\, MN \n  \n  \n  \n  \n  \nWinona’s beloved Messiah Sing-In returns on Saturday\, December 6 at 7:00 p.m. at Central Lutheran Church\, continuing a tradition that has delighted audiences since 1991. This year’s program\, led by founding director Dr. Harry A. Mechell\, brings an exciting\, family- friendly flair\, featuring a selection of holiday and seasonal favorites along with the cherished choruses from Part One of Handel’s Messiah. The program is just an hour long\, so it’s a great way for everyone\, no matter their age\, to sing\, hum\, or just soak in the fun\, festive vibe. \nNew this year\, families will be treated to an array of beloved seasonal pieces\, including the energetic Polar Express Medley with “Hot Chocolate\,” the magical music of The Snowman\, favorites from How the Grinch Stole Christmas\, and the lively Fezziwig’s Frolic. Directed by Kurt Speltz\, the Winona Community Chorale\, a vibrant 60 voice ensemble\, will lend its rich harmonies to the evening’s celebration\, bringing an added warmth and festive spirit to this year’s program. \nThe event will feature BellaMusica\, a high-caliber community chamber choir known for its expressive performances accompanied by a professional orchestra composed of some of the finest musicians in Southeast Minnesota. Special guest soloist Joel Mathias\, whose distinguished career includes engagements with opera houses across the United States\, most notably the Minnesota Opera\, will bring a refined vocal artistry and dramatic sensitivity to the evening’s performance. \nIn the spirit of community\, attendees are encouraged to bring non-perishable food items or make a monetary donation to Winona Volunteer Services. Tickets will be available at the door: $15 for adults and $5 for students and seniors. SUMMARY:AMERICAN NOMAD – TRUMPET & ORGAN CONCERT
DESCRIPTION:November 23 | 3;00 pm\nCentral Lutheran Church\nWinona\, MN \nAcclaimed Minnesota Orchestra and former Canadian Brass trumpeter Charles Lazarus teams up with organist and former Director of the National Lutheran Choir\, David Cherwien for an afternoon of exciting and virtuosic music making. The free concert takes place at Central Lutheran Church on Sunday\, November 23\, 2025\, at 3:00 pm. \nAt the center of the genre-jumping performance by the will be American Nomad\, a classical/jazz hybrid concerto for trumpet written by Emmy Award-winning composer\, Steve Heitzeg. The program will include selections from Lazarus’ latest recording of modern takes on hymns and spirituals along with Cherwien / Lazarus originals and classical favorites. \nThe performance is free and open to all. SUMMARY:Winona Community Chorale Presents Fall Concert “Songs from the Silver Screen”
DESCRIPTION:Friday\, Nov. 7 | 7:00 pm\nSaturday\, Nov. 8 | 2:00 pm\nCentral Lutheran Church\n259 W Wabasha St.\, Winona. \n The Winona Community Chorale will present its fall concert\, “Songs from the Silver Screen: From Mozart to ABBA and Beyond\,” on November 7 and 8 at Central Lutheran Church. There is no admission charge\, but a free-will offering will be collected. \nThe Winona Community Chorale is a mixed choral ensemble performing music from a wide variety of styles\, genres and time periods. Directed by Kurt Speltz\, the group was founded in January 2023 and is now in its sixth concert season. The choir has grown over this time from approximately 30 to 60 members. The vision of the Winona Community Chorale is to inspire a love and appreciation for exceptional choral singing in our area\, and to ignite the joy and human connection it generates. \nThis fall’s concert program features pieces either originally from\, or heard in\, the movies. It includes an eclectic mix of music ranging from Mozart’s “Lacrymosa\,” to Elton John’s “Circle of Life” from The Lion King and Enya’s “May It Be” from The Lord of the Rings: The Fellowship of the Ring\, to songs by ABBA\, Lady Gaga\, and much more. Members of the Chorale will also perform instrumental movie music for about fifteen minutes prior to the start of each concert. \nThose unable to attend in person can also view a livestream of the concert via the choir’s page at “Winona Community Chorale” on Facebook. \nFor more information about the Chorale\, contact Kurt Speltz\, Director\, at WinonaCommunityChorale@gmail.com\, or follow the choir on Facebook. SUMMARY:Final Hendrickson Organ Recital December 18
DESCRIPTION:Central Lutheran Church | 259 W Wabasha St.\nsites.google.com/centrallutheranchurch.org/hendrickson-30th \nCentral Lutheran’s year-long celebration of their magnificent Hendrickson Pipe Organ will conclude triumphantly on December 18 from noon to 1 pm. Scott Turkington will perform works by Bach\, Bossi\, Franck\, Boëllmann\, Rowley\, Saint-Martine\, and Vierne. The recital is free and open to all. Donations collected from a freewill offering will support the instrument’s upcoming renovation. Scott Turkington will be familiar to all who have attended Central’s Messiah Sing-In the past two years. As an organ recitalist\, he has played innumerable U.S. recitals\, having made his New York debut at St. Patrick’s Cathedral\, and in Washington\, D.C.\, at the Washington National Cathedral. Turkington currently serves as organist and choirmaster for the Shrine of Our Lady of Guadalupe in La Crosse. Learn more.
